Sorin Inc., a company that produces and sells a single product, has provided its contribution format income statement for Januar

y. Sales (3,400 units) $ 88,400 Variable expenses 43,316 Contribution margin 45,084 Fixed expenses 33,400 Net operating income $ 11,684 If the company sells 3,800 units, its total contribution margin should be closest to: (Do not round intermediate calculations.)

Answer:

Total Contribution Margin= $50,388

Explanation:

Giving the following information:

Sales (3,400 units) $ 88,400

Variable expenses 43,316

We need to calculate the selling price and unitary variable cost:

Selling price= 88,400/3,400= $26

Unitary variable cost= 43,316/3,400= $12.74

Now, we can calculate the total contribution margin for 3,800 units.

Sales= 26*3,800= 98,800

Variable cost= 12.74*3,800= (48,412)

Contribution margin= 50,388
